f578bc2984
Adds an svg version of the logo, a script to generate icons from it, and generated icon files for the logo (with and without the VOID text) at various sizes, which are installed to the hicolor (fallback) icon theme. The logo files are pre-generated to avoid makedep on librsvg-utils, and they are small enough and change so rarely that it is not a big deal to include them in git. The source svg is slightly different than the one on alpha.de; it has a small white border added to help with legibility on dark backgrounds. This is a follow-up to #35604
22 lines
1 KiB
Bash
22 lines
1 KiB
Bash
# Template file for 'void-artwork'
|
|
pkgname=void-artwork
|
|
version=20220303
|
|
revision=1
|
|
short_desc="Void Linux artwork"
|
|
maintainer="Enno Boland <gottox@voidlinux.org>"
|
|
license="custom:Public Domain" #no vlicense check
|
|
homepage="http://www.voidlinux.org"
|
|
|
|
do_install() {
|
|
vinstall ${FILESDIR}/splash.png 644 usr/share/void-artwork
|
|
vinstall ${FILESDIR}/splashwhite.png 644 usr/share/void-artwork
|
|
vinstall ${FILESDIR}/void-logo.png 644 usr/share/void-artwork
|
|
vinstall ${FILESDIR}/void-transparent.png 644 usr/share/void-artwork
|
|
vinstall ${FILESDIR}/void-logo.svg 644 usr/share/void-artwork
|
|
for size in 16 22 32 48 64 128 256 512; do
|
|
vinstall ${FILESDIR}/icons/void-logo-${size}.png 644 usr/share/icons/hicolor/${size}x${size}/apps void-logo.png
|
|
vinstall ${FILESDIR}/icons/void-logo-notext-${size}.png 644 usr/share/icons/hicolor/${size}x${size}/apps void-logo-notext.png
|
|
done
|
|
vinstall ${FILESDIR}/icons/void-logo.svg 644 usr/share/icons/hicolor/scalable/apps
|
|
vinstall ${FILESDIR}/icons/void-logo-notext.svg 644 usr/share/icons/hicolor/scalable/apps
|
|
}
|